This contract involves the secure and trackable delivery of IT devices to federal sites throughout Canada, encompassing full logistics coordination from origin to final destination. It requires comprehensive customs clearance procedures, end-to-end tracking capabilities, and last-mile delivery services to ensure timely, compliant, and tamper-proof transportation of sensitive equipment across all regions of the country. The work will be performed nationwide with no specific city or provincial restrictions, and all deliveries must meet federal security and logistical standards. The contract is classified as a subcontract under NAICS code 484121, which corresponds to general freight trucking, and is being managed by Shared Services Canada on behalf of the Government of Canada. The solicitation was posted on June 29, 2026, with responses due by July 30, 2026. Bidders must be prepared to handle the complexities of cross-border and domestic shipping for federal assets, including adherence to government security protocols, documentation requirements, and delivery timelines, with a focus on accountability and visibility throughout the entire supply chain.

Shared Services Canada (SSC) is seeking to establish a framework for delivering Local Internet Access Services (LIAS) across federal government sites nationwide through a Request for Supply Arrangement (RFSA) under solicitation BPM014160. The objective is to pre-qualify internet service providers capable of meeting the technical, security, and service delivery requirements for LIAS on an as-needed basis, servicing SSC, its partner organizations, mandatory clients, and other federal departments that opt to use this procurement pathway. Qualified suppliers will be issued Supply Arrangements that function as indefinite delivery/indefinite quantity (IDIQ)-like agreements, enabling the issuance of individual Service Orders for installation, moves, changes, disconnections, and ongoing maintenance of internet connections. The process is not a competitive bidding event but rather a selection mechanism to build a roster of vetted providers to streamline future procurements, standardize contracting, improve invoicing efficiency, and replace legacy agreements as they expire. Suppliers must register and submit responses exclusively through SSC’s Procure to Pay (P2P) Portal, with mandatory documentation including a structured response spreadsheet covering technical capability, financial information, compliance certifications, and declarations related to Indigenous business status, former public sector employment, and integrity. Key requirements include holding a valid Designated Organization Screening from Public Services and Procurement Canada, ensuring all personnel accessing sensitive sites have Reliability Status clearance, and supporting native IPv6 dual-stack configurations without tunneling. Contractors must comply with strict service level objectives, report security and privacy breaches immediately, retain access logs for seven years, and submit invoices electronically via the P2P Portal. Pricing must exclude voice services, and construction-related costs require prior written approval. Performance is tied to Service Orders with delivery locations defined per request, and acceptance occurs at the site after government-led testing. Options exist for contract extensions and emergency infrastructure scaling, with audit rights preserved to validate pricing and compliance.
